应用运维管理系统如何实现数据可视化?
随着信息技术的飞速发展,企业对数据的需求日益增长。应用运维管理系统作为企业信息化建设的重要组成部分,如何实现数据可视化,已经成为许多企业关注的焦点。本文将深入探讨应用运维管理系统如何实现数据可视化,以及其带来的诸多益处。
一、数据可视化的意义
数据可视化是指将数据以图形、图像、图表等形式呈现,使人们能够直观地理解和分析数据。在应用运维管理系统中,数据可视化具有以下重要意义:
- 提高数据分析效率:通过图形化的方式,将复杂的数据关系和趋势直观地展现出来,使运维人员能够快速找到问题所在,提高工作效率。
- 降低沟通成本:数据可视化使非技术人员也能轻松理解数据,从而降低沟通成本,提高团队协作效率。
- 辅助决策:通过数据可视化,企业可以更好地了解业务状况,为决策提供有力支持。
二、应用运维管理系统实现数据可视化的方法
- 选择合适的可视化工具
目前,市面上有许多可视化工具可供选择,如ECharts、Highcharts、D3.js等。企业应根据自身需求,选择合适的可视化工具。以下是一些选择可视化工具时需要考虑的因素:
- 易用性:选择易于上手、功能丰富的可视化工具。
- 兼容性:确保可视化工具与现有系统兼容。
- 性能:选择性能优秀的可视化工具,以保证数据展示的流畅性。
- 数据采集与处理
数据采集是数据可视化的基础。企业需要建立完善的数据采集机制,确保数据的准确性和完整性。以下是一些数据采集的方法:
- 日志采集:通过采集系统日志,获取系统运行状态、性能指标等信息。
- 性能监控:通过性能监控工具,实时获取系统资源使用情况、网络流量等信息。
- 业务数据采集:通过业务系统接口,获取业务数据,如用户行为、交易数据等。
数据处理是数据可视化的关键。企业需要对采集到的数据进行清洗、转换、整合等处理,以满足可视化需求。
- 设计可视化图表
设计可视化图表是数据可视化的核心环节。以下是一些设计可视化图表时需要考虑的因素:
- 图表类型:根据数据特点选择合适的图表类型,如柱状图、折线图、饼图等。
- 图表布局:合理布局图表,使数据展示清晰易懂。
- 色彩搭配:选择合适的色彩搭配,增强视觉效果。
- 集成可视化组件
将设计好的可视化图表集成到应用运维管理系统中,实现数据可视化。以下是一些集成可视化组件的方法:
- 自定义组件:根据需求开发自定义可视化组件。
- 第三方组件库:利用第三方组件库,如ECharts、Highcharts等,快速实现数据可视化。
三、案例分析
案例一:某企业采用ECharts可视化工具,将系统日志、性能监控数据、业务数据等整合到应用运维管理系统中,实现了数据可视化。通过数据可视化,企业及时发现系统故障、优化资源配置,提高了运维效率。
案例二:某互联网公司采用D3.js可视化工具,将用户行为数据、交易数据等可视化,为产品优化和运营决策提供了有力支持。
四、总结
应用运维管理系统实现数据可视化,有助于提高运维效率、降低沟通成本、辅助决策。企业应根据自身需求,选择合适的可视化工具、数据采集方法、图表设计方法和集成方法,实现数据可视化。随着信息技术的不断发展,数据可视化将在应用运维管理系统中发挥越来越重要的作用。
猜你喜欢:云网监控平台